Ingredients
4 portion(s)
Bulgolgi (Korean Beef)
- 750 grams rib eye steak boneless
- 1/2 --- small pear
- 60 grams soy sauce (low sodium)
- 2 heaped tablespoons Soft brown sugar
- 3 cloves garlic
- 2 pieces ginger, stem (10g)
- 2 level tablespoons sesame oil
- 1 level tbsp gochujang (Korean red pepper paste)
- 2 level tbsp vegetable oil
- 4 brown onion, thick sliced
- 2 green onion, sliced
- 2 level teaspoons sesame seeds, to serve

Recipe's preparation
-
Wrap meat in plastic and place in freezer for 30 mins. Unwrap and slice across the grain as thinly as possible (5mm best)
Slice onions into med thick slices. - Place pear, soy sauce, brown sugar, korean pepper paste, sesame oil, garlic and ginger into TM bowl.
- Put lid with mc in place. Blend for 25 secs at speed 5.5
- Combine the soy sauce mixture with the meat and onions. Leave to marinade overnight if possible. Min 2 hours.
- Heat tablespoon for vegetable oil in pan over medium-high heat. Working in batches add 1/2 the steak and onions and fry until slightly charred and cooked through, flipping once, about 2-3 minutes.
-
Repeat with remaining vegetable oil and steak and onions.
Serve immediately with rice, sliced green onions and sprinkled with sesame seeds if desired.
